But, if even after all of that, you're still dubious about the obvious dangers involved, let's hear what a professional has to say about it.

Reacting to the video, which was posted on TikTok a couple of years back - though has since been deleted by the looks of it - and racked up thousands of views and comments, an account called @firedepartmentchronicles explained why it was so dangerous.

They said: "Just remember two things before you try the newest Darwinism challenge. Number one, water expands 1,700 times its normal size when it's converted to steam.

"Number two, it's really hard to call 911 when you're screaming in pain when you're covered in boiling hot grease."
